Arya B. Gaduh
Researcher, Department of Economics
Email |Print
  Biography Publications Opinions  

Research interests
Economic modelling, social learning in networks, economic integration

Arya B. Gaduh is an economist, currently responsible for the development of CSIS’s macroeconometric model. He also participates in a study on ASEAN economic integration. He is also a consultant for the World Bank project on the educational experiment in Central Java.

Apart from research, he ocassionally lectured, inter alia, at the Prasetiya Mulya Graduate School of Management. Occasionally, he writes for national newspapers.

Arya received his bachelor’s degree in Computer Science from the University of California at Berkeley in 1996 and immediately joined the Centre in early 1997. In 2000, he received the British Chevening Award to pursue a Graduate Diploma in Economics at the University of Cambridge, UK.

A year later, he was awarded the Citibank-Cambridge Scholarship to continue to the Master of Philosophy (MPhil) program at Cambridge. He received his MPhil in Economics degree in 2002 with a thesis entitled 'Information and social networks in village economies'.
